The Primary Study Of Cultivation Of Agaricus Blazei In ShanXi

This paper appraised and analysized the productive properties of five kinds of Agaricus blazei by its cultivated property,biological efficiency and nutritional components of fruitbodies,studied the growth vigour,the growth rate,property of distribution of Agaricus blazei mycelia in five mother culture media,and studied the technics of cultivation using Fussy analysis method of orthogonal experimental design on wheat straw compost in ShanXi.On the basis of high-yield technology,the paper discussed the law of utilization of nutritional components and the chang of extracellular enzyme,s activity during its growth on wheat straw.The results showed as follows: (1)In the five kinds of Agaricus blazei cultivation,the properties of cultivation and biological efficiency of S5 are higher than those of S1,S2,S3 and S4.The differences of nutrional components of the five kinds of Agaricus blazei are not significant,but the nutritional components of S5 are a little higher than those of S1,S2 and S3 and nearly the same as those of S4. (2)Selected a optimum mother culture media through studied the growth vigour,the growth rate,property of distribution of Agaricus blazei mycelium. The optimum medium was bran 100g,potato 200g,glucose 20g,MgSO4 0.5g,KH2PO4 1.5g,agar 20g and water1000ml. (3)The different cultivation medium treatment,spawning method and the material of casing soil affected directly the yield of Agaricus blazei. The thickness of casing soil of three factors had the greatest effect on the biological efficiency,next the cultivation medium treatment , once more the spawning method.The results indicated that the optimum combinations of three factors was the combination of adoption 0.5%EM formnentation,surface-spawning,and casing three point five or three centimeters. (4)The degradation rate of lignin at the stage of mycelial growth was higher than that of cellulose and hemicellulose,facilitating the degradation of cellulose and hemicellulose of the fungus. Agaricus blazei used not only lignocellulose but nonlignocellulose The activities of enzyme such as cellulase,hemicellulase,amylase,protease,laccase and peroxidase changed correspondly.
